[發明專利]封閉域的智能人機對話系統有效
| 申請號: | 201710973047.X | 申請日: | 2017-10-18 |
| 公開(公告)號: | CN108415923B | 公開(公告)日: | 2020-12-11 |
| 發明(設計)人: | 鄂海紅;宋美娜;胡鶯夕;趙文駿;王昕睿;趙鑫祿;陳忠富;祝一帆 | 申請(專利權)人: | 北京郵電大學 |
| 主分類號: | G06F16/332 | 分類號: | G06F16/332;G06F16/35;G06F40/30;G06K9/62;G10L15/22;G10L15/26;G10L15/16;G10L15/02;G10L15/18 |
| 代理公司: | 北京清亦華知識產權代理事務所(普通合伙) 11201 | 代理人: | 張潤 |
| 地址: | 100876 北京市海淀區西*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 封閉 智能 人機對話 系統 | ||
1.一種封閉域的智能人機對話系統,其特征在于,包括:
第一建模模塊,用于基于雙向長短時記憶網絡BiLSTM和卷積神經網絡CNN構建多特征融合深度意圖識別模型,以提取并融合用戶輸入的短文本不同粒度、維度的特征;
第二建模模塊,用于采用人機對話狀態系統當前狀態輸入與上下文語句聯合建模方式來構建基于MC-BLSTM-MSCNN的對話狀態跟蹤模型,以提取槽值對特征;所述對話狀態跟蹤模型包括:語義解碼模塊和上下文編碼模塊;
所述語義解碼模塊用于直接交互用戶輸入的向量表示r與候選槽值對表示c,并通過向量r與候選槽值對c判斷用戶是否明確表達了與當前候選對相匹配的意圖;
所述上下文編碼模塊用于獲取系統向用戶詢問特定槽tq和系統請用戶確認特定的槽值對(ts,tv),并根據所述tq和(ts,tv)計算相似度的度量,其中,計算所述相似度的度量包括:系統輸出行為(tq,ts,tv)、候選槽值對(cs,cv)和用戶輸入語句表示r;系統輸出行為(tq,ts,tv)、候選槽值對(cs,cv)和用戶輸入語句表示r為計算相似性度量d會用到的參數;
第三建模模塊,用于構建基于移位注意力機制的域外恢復機制的Bi-LSTM匹配模型,以將識別到的用戶意圖、用戶槽值輸入移位網絡進行注意力機制的權重分發,實現對話狀態的編碼和對話控制的匹配。
2.根據權利要求1所述的封閉域的智能人機對話系統,其特征在于,所述多特征融合深度意圖識別模型至少包括:多通道嵌入層、高速通道層和多粒度卷積層。
3.根據權利要求1所述的封閉域的智能人機對話系統,其特征在于,所述候選槽值對的槽名稱與值的向量空間表示由cs和cv給出,將所述候選槽值對的槽名稱與值的向量空間表示的元組映射成與用戶輸入的向量表示r相同維度的單個向量c,其中,這兩個向量表示進行交互以學習一種相似性度量,該相似性度量用于區分用戶輸入語句與其所表達或者不表達的槽值對之間的交互作用,所述相似性度量具體如下:
其中,表示element-wise向量乘法,其將d中豐富的特征集合減少到單個標量,允許下游網絡通過學習r和c中的特征集之間的非線性交互來更好地利用其參數。
4.根據權利要求1所述的封閉域的智能人機對話系統,其特征在于,所述系統輸出行為(tq,ts,tv)、候選槽值對(cs,cv)和用戶輸入語句表示r之間存在如下關系:
mr=(cs·tq)r
mc=(cs·ts)(cv·tv)r
其中,·表示點積,當系統詢問當前的候選槽或槽值對時,所計算的相似項用作僅通過話語表示的選通門控機制。
5.根據權利要求4所述的封閉域的智能人機對話系統,其特征在于,所述上下文編碼模塊還用于將得到的向量表示m與語義相似度的向量表示d統一輸入到Softmax層,進行分類。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于北京郵電大學,未經北京郵電大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710973047.X/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:數據庫修改方法及應用服務器
- 下一篇:圖像處理裝置以及圖像處理方法





